Rozumice Nature Reserve

Rozumice
50°00'54"N 17°59'18"E (50.015109, 17.988599)
The Rozumice nature reserve is located a few hundred meters southeast of the village of Rozumice, right on the border with the Czech Republic. It was created to protect a deciduous forest with natural features and the presence of protected and rare species in the undergrowth. Oak-hornbeam, riparian forest, and oak woodland communities occur here. The tree stand includes: small-leaved linden, pedunculate oak, European ash, silver birch, sessile oak, and common hornbeam. The presence of over two hundred species of vascular plants has been recorded in the reserve, which places the "Rozumice" reserve at the top of the list of Opole reserves in terms of species richness. Practical information: The reserve is open for sightseeing. Free admission. Parking spaces by the Church of the Most Sacred Heart of Jesus in Rozumice.
